Cricket World Cup: Shubman Gill takes special training ahead of India-England match
India's stylish opener, Subhman Gill attended the optional training section on Friday at Ekana Stadium in Lucknow ahead of Team India's clash against England on Sunday. During the training session, Gill called a member of the staff with special stuff, like a badminton racket and tennis ball, reported news agency ANI. Following this, he practiced a short ball as he was dismissed in a short ball against New Zealand, and this time he didn't want to repeat the mistake. Coming to India's previous game against New Zealand, which Rohit Sharma's side won easily, Sharma's side put New Zealand to bat first. 'Men in Blue' were off to a good start, reducing Kiwis to 19/2 in powerplay.

Zara owner Inditex's suppliers to buy 2,000 tons of fibre recycled from cotton waste
MADRID (Reuters) — Zara owner Inditex (BME:ITX), the world's largest clothing retailer, said on Friday its suppliers would buy 2,000 metric tons of a raw material made out of cotton textile waste by Swedish company Renewcell.

Smart Rebound! Sensex climbs over 500 points after 6-day selloff as US Treasury yields subside
The BSE Sensex was trading 500 points higher, above 63,600. Nifty50 was trading above 19,000, up 155 points at around 9.50 a.m. From the Sensex stocks, Infosys, Tata Steel, M&M, NTPC, SBI and Wipro opened with gains, while only Asian Paints, UltraTech Cement, and HUL opened with cuts. Among individual stocks, Karnataka Bank rose 5% after the board of the bank approved the allotment of Rs 800 crore on a preferential basis. Meanwhile, Vodafone Idea shares traded nearly 3% higher despite its consolidated net loss widened to Rs 8,738 crore in Q2 FY24 from Rs 7,595 crore in Q2 FY23. All major sectoral indices logged gains.

Blue Jet Healthcare IPO: Check GMP, subscription status on day 2, apply or not?
On day 1, Blue Jet Healthcare IPO was subscribed 69%, where the retail investors portion was subscribed 78%, NII portion was subscribed 1.37 times, and Qualified Institutional Buyers (QIB) portion was booked 1%. Blue Jet Healthcare IPO price band has been fixed in the range of ₹329 to ₹346 per equity share of face value of ₹2. Blue Jet Healthcare IPO has reserved not more than 50% of the shares in the public issue for Qualified Institutional Buyers (QIB), not less than 15% for Non Institutional Investors (NII), and not less than 35% of the offer is reserved for Retail Investors.

Gold rate today under pressure. Experts recommend buy as US treasury yield retraces from 16-year high
Gold rate today: On account of 10-year US bond yield retracing from 16-year higher levels of 5 per cent and dip in US dollar against major global currencies, commodnity market experts have recommended investors to buy precious bullion metals in current dip. They said that weakness in the US dollar and 10-year US Treasury yield is expected to enable gold and silver prices to bounce back from its support levels. Gold price today opened lower at ₹60,.478 per 10 gm levels and went on to hit intraday low of ₹60,436 levels within few minutes of comodity market's opening bell during Wednesday morning deals on Multi Commodity Exchange (MCX).

Vietnam's Vinfast committed to selling EVs to US despite challenges
Vietnamese automaker Vinfast has plunged right into the crowded and hypercompetitive U.S. auto market, gambling that if it can sell its electric vehicles to finicky Americans, it can succeed anywhere
